When I lived in Alaska I did a lot of big game hunting with the bow. I got drawn for a cow tag on Elmendorf AFB. I followed this big cow around for almost the entire day, before I got a shot, it was getting dark, so it was shoot or go home. I had a 60# Martin Long bow and 700gr. hand made arrows. The shot was 65 paces, longer than I usually liked to shoot, after the shot the moose walked about 50 yards and started walking in circles and then she went down. The arrow had gone through both lungs and stopped on a rib on the far side. We were able to drive the truck right up to the moose, a pretty easy butchering job.
